Package Contains all of the classes for creating user interfaces and for painting graphics and images. See: Description. The Java AWT (Abstract Windowing Toolkit) contains the fundamental classes used for constructing GUIs. The abstract Component class is the base class for the AWT. Many AWT classes are derived from it. These are the old AWT components that are no longer in use. The Abstract Window Toolkit(AWT) contains numerous classes and methods that allow you to create and manage windows. Although the main.


Author: Bettie Hyatt Sr.
Country: Tunisia
Language: English
Genre: Education
Published: 16 June 2014
Pages: 601
PDF File Size: 2.29 Mb
ePub File Size: 10.81 Mb
ISBN: 710-7-56667-619-2
Downloads: 99130
Price: Free
Uploader: Bettie Hyatt Sr.

Download Now

AWT also makes some higher level functionality available to applications, such as: Also, a platform may further restrict maximum size and location coordinates. The exact maximum values are dependent on the platform. awt classes in java


There is no way to awt classes in java these maximum values, either in Java code or in native code. In other words, you never invoke actionPerformed in your codes explicitly. The actionPerformed is called back by the graphics subsystem under certain circumstances in response to certain user actions.


Three kinds of objects are involved in the event-handling: The source object such as Button and Textfield interacts with the user. Upon triggered, the source object creates an event object to capture the action e. This event object will be messaged to all the registered listener object sand an appropriate event-handler method awt classes in java the listener s is called-back to provide the response.

What is Abstract Window Toolkit (AWT)? - Definition from

In other words, triggering a source fires an event to all its listener sand invoke an appropriate event handler of the listener s. To express interest for a certain source's event, the listener s must be registered with the source. In other words, the listener s "subscribes" to a source's event, and the source "publishes" the event to all its subscribers upon activation.

awt classes in java

This is known as subscribe-publish or observable-observer design pattern. The sequence of steps is illustrated above: The source object registers its listener s for a certain type of event.

What are AWT Classes in Java ~ Java Help and Support

A source fires an event when triggered. How the source and listener understand each other? The answer is via an agreed-upon interface.

  • GUI Programming - Java Programming Tutorial
  • Other AWT Classes
  • Abstract Window Toolkit - Wikipedia
  • Abstract Window Toolkit (AWT)
  • AWT Hierarchy
  • Package java.awt Description
  • Package java.awt

For example, if a source is capable of firing an event called XxxEvent e. Firstly, we need to declare an interface called XxxListener e. For example, the MouseListener interface is declared as follows with five operational modes.

That is, the listeners must provide their own implementations i. In this way, the listener s can response to these events appropriately. The signature of the methods are:

Other Posts: